About Sir MVIT

Updated 30 Jul 2026
Sir M. Visvesvaraya Institute of Technology, commonly known as Sir MVIT, is a private affiliated college in Bengaluru established in 1986 by Sri Krishnadevaraya Educational Trust. The institution is located at Krishnadevaraya Nagar, Hunasamaranahalli, off International Airport Road in the Yelahanka area. It occupies a green 133-acre campus and operates as an affiliated institution of Visvesvaraya Technological University, Belagavi. The institute is approved by the All India Council for Technical Education, holds an A grade from NAAC and reports that six programmes are accredited by the National Board of Accreditation.

The academic portfolio spans engineering, management and computer applications. At undergraduate level, Sir MVIT lists thirteen four-year BE programmes. These include long-established branches such as Civil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Biotechnology, Computer Science and Engineering, Information Science and Engineering, Electrical and Electronics Engineering, Electronics and Communication Engineering, and Electronics and Telecommunication Engineering. Newer options cover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ning, Computer Science and Engineering (Data Science), Internet of Things and Cybersecurity including Blockchain Technology, Electronics and Computer Engineering, and Robotics and Artificial Intelligence. Lateral-entry routes are also available for eligible diploma holders through the applicable Karnataka admission process.

Postgraduate study includes M.Tech programmes in Electronics and Communication Engineering, Robotics and Artificial Intelligence, Biotechnology and Biochemical Engineering, Construction Technology and Computer Integrated Manufacturing, together with MBA and MCA programmes. The official eligibility information links engineering admission with KCET, COMEDK UGET, Karnataka PGCET and GATE as applicable, while MBA and MCA applicants may need scores from Karnataka PGCET, KMAT or CMAT depending on the programme and quota.

The institute describes every department as a recognised research and development centre of the affiliating university. Its academic infrastructure includes departmental laboratories, project laboratories, seminar halls, a library and information centre, an internet browsing centre and facilities for research and consultancy. The campus also supports technical chapters, cultural groups, entrepreneurship activities, NSS, sports and student development programmes.

Residential and everyday campus facilities include separate accommodation for men and women, a canteen, healthcare access, transportation, banking and ATM services, indoor and outdoor sports, staff quarters and Wi-Fi or network infrastructure. The official facilities page reports four men’s hostels and three women’s hostels with approximate capacities of 640 and 580 respectively. The library occupies a separate block of about 1,700 square metres and reports more than 64,000 book volumes.

Sir MVIT has a dedicated training and placement cell that begins career-preparation activities during the degree programme. Training covers aptitude, communication, personality development and employability. Placement outcomes vary by year and data definition. For 2024-25, Careers360 presents 330 placed graduates out of 514 graduates, a 67.9% placement rate and a median salary of INR 6 lakh for its displayed four-year undergraduate dataset. A separate campus-drive comparison lists 331 offers and 46 participating companies for 2025, with the highest listed package at INR 15.73 lakh per annum. The institute homepage also highlights newer individual offers for the 2025-26 placement cycle; these are recorded separately so that figures from different periods are not combined.

Admission routes are quota-dependent. The official admissions page describes 45% of BE intake through Karnataka CET, an additional supernumerary tuition-fee-waiver provision, 30% through COMEDK UGET and 25% through management quota, with merit and eligibility requirements continuing to apply. Applicants should confirm the latest counselling schedule, fees, documents and vacancy position with the relevant authority or the institute before making a payment.

Sir MVIT can suit students who prefer a large campus, a broad selection of conventional and emerging engineering branches, access to Bengaluru’s technology ecosystem and an established alumni and recruiter network. The choice of programme, quota and expected expenditure should nevertheless be evaluated carefully using current official notices because fees, seat matrices, cut-offs, accreditation validity and placement results can change from one academic cycle to another.

When was Sir MVIT established?

Sir MVIT was established in 1986 by Sri Krishnadevaraya Educational Trust.

Is Sir MVIT a government or private college?

It is a private affiliated college. The institute is affiliated with Visvesvaraya Technological University and approved by AICTE.

Which entrance exams are accepted for BE admission?

The principal BE routes are KCET and COMEDK UGET. The official admissions page also describes an eligible management-quota route.

Does Sir MVIT offer management-quota admission?

Yes. The official admission procedure states that 25% of the total BE intake is reserved for management quota. Candidates must confirm current eligibility, vacancies, fees and the authorised payment process directly with the institute.

What is the minimum eligibility for regular BE admission?

The official page states 10+2 with Physics and Mathematics plus an eligible third subject and at least 45% in the specified subjects, relaxed to 40% for eligible Karnataka reserved-category candidates.

How large is the Sir MVIT campus?

The institute reports a 133-acre campus at Hunasamaranahalli near Yelahanka in Bengaluru.

Does Sir MVIT provide hostel accommodation?

The institute lists four men’s hostels and three women’s hostels, with approximate capacities of 640 boys and 580 girls. Accommodation availability should be confirmed at admission.

What were the displayed 2025 placement figures?

Careers360 lists 46 participating companies, 331 offers and a highest package of INR 15.73 LPA for 2025. The institute homepage separately highlights newer individual offers for 2025-26.

What was the displayed 2024-25 median salary?

The displayed four-year undergraduate placement table reports a median salary of INR 6 lakh for 2024-25.

Which postgraduate programmes are available?

The supplied sources list M.Tech programmes, MBA and MCA. Current specialisations and intake should be checked before applying.

Does Sir MVIT offer scholarships?

The sources point to Karnataka state, national and AICTE schemes, along with a supernumerary tuition-fee-waiver provision for eligible applicants through the Karnataka route.

What facilities are available?

Facilities include hostels, library, laboratories, sports, gym, cafeteria, healthcare, transport, IT infrastructure, seminar spaces, bank/ATM services and student clubs.

What is the 2025 KCET General Round 1 closing rank for CSE?

College Pravesh lists a closing rank of 16,331 for Computer Science and Engineering in the displayed 2025 KCET General Round 1 table.

Is the institute accredited?

The official site reports NAAC A grade, AICTE approval and six programmes accredited by the National Board of Accreditation.

Where is Sir MVIT located?

The campus is at Krishnadevaraya Nagar, Hunasamaranahalli, International Airport Road, Yelahanka, Bengaluru, Karnataka 562157.
